Six Police Officers of "Special Forces" Are Arrested in Chiapas for "Establishing" a Detainee

Summary by Turquesa News
Six police officers of the Pakal Immediate Reaction Force (FRIP) an elite group created by the Chiapas government to combat organized crime in the entity were arrested after being shown beating a detainee with a table. The scene of abuse of authority was captured on video and shared on social networks, in which one sees the torture of a young man arrested during an operation against crime in the municipality of Chilon.
